Transaction 73590f8afd1a993b5dc162fdbbe94435fee31cca7540355f79df1bc85a7ddf83
1 Input
1 Output
-
73590f8afd1a993b5dc162fdbbe94435fee31cca7540355f79df1bc85a7ddf83:0
- value
- 813653
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a2931f4acb57f30d563a189a2f5ace410943408
- address
- bc1qrg5nra9vk4lnp4tr5xy69advusgfgdqg7r4hyu